Instantly convert modern WebP images to Base64 online for free – fast, efficient, and perfect for embedding in web applications.
🖼️ Upload WebP Image
📋 Base64 Output:
💡 How to Use the WebP to Base64 Converter
1. Click “Choose File” and select a WebP image from your device.
2. The image will be automatically converted, and the Base64 string will appear in the output field, along with a preview.
3. Click “Copy Base64” to copy the string to your clipboard.
4. “Clear” will reset the converter.
In the relentless pursuit of faster and more efficient websites, the choice of image format plays a pivotal role. For years, developers have relied on JPEG, PNG, and GIF, but the modern web demands more. This is where WebP, Google’s next-generation image format, shines. By offering superior compression, WebP allows for high-quality images at significantly smaller file sizes. To further leverage this efficiency, developers can embed these images directly into their code using Base64 encoding, a task made simple by a WebP to Base64 Converter.
This article is your ultimate guide to the WebP to Base64 Converter. We will explore the power of the WebP format, the purpose of Base64 encoding, and how combining the two can unlock new levels of performance for your web projects. Whether you are a front-end developer, a UI designer, or an SEO professional, this tool and the techniques it enables are essential for building the fast, responsive websites that users and search engines love.
What is a WebP to Base64 Converter?
A WebP to Base64 Converter is a specialized online tool that takes a WebP image file and transforms its binary data into a Base64 text string. WebP is a cutting-edge image format that supports both lossy and lossless compression, as well as animation and alpha transparency. This makes it a versatile and highly efficient alternative to older formats like JPEG and PNG. Base64 is an encoding scheme that translates binary data into a text representation, allowing it to be safely embedded within text-based files like HTML, CSS, or JSON.
The primary function of this converter is to create a data URI for a WebP image. A data URI is a scheme that allows you to embed files, in this case, an image, directly into your documents. By doing so, you eliminate the need for the browser to make a separate HTTP request to fetch the image file from a server. This is a powerful optimization technique, especially when applied to the already-efficient WebP format.
A common real-life scenario is the optimization of a website’s hero image or critical icons. A developer can create a highly compressed WebP version of an icon to reduce its file size. Then, by using a WebP to Base64 Converter, they can embed this tiny, high-quality image directly into the CSS or HTML. This ensures that the icon is displayed instantly as the page loads, without waiting for an external file, which can significantly improve the perceived performance and the Largest Contentful Paint (LCP) score, a key metric for user experience and SEO.
Why Use a WebP to Base64 Converter?
Using a WebP to Base64 Converter is a strategic choice for performance-focused web development. It combines the benefits of a next-generation image format with a powerful embedding technique, leading to tangible improvements in speed, efficiency, and productivity.
Improves Workflow or Saves Time
Manually encoding any image file is a cumbersome task that involves multiple steps and is prone to error. A fast WebP to Base64 Converter automates this process into a single, seamless action. This allows developers and designers to quickly encode their optimized WebP assets without disrupting their workflow, saving valuable time and effort that can be better spent on other development tasks.
Works Online Without Installation
Our converter is a completely browser-based utility, meaning you don’t need to download or install any specific software. This makes it a universally accessible tool, available on any device with an internet connection. It eliminates the friction of setting up a local development environment for a simple encoding task, offering a convenient, on-demand solution.
Optimized for Speed and Convenience
Our tool is engineered for high performance, providing near-instantaneous encoding of your WebP files. The user interface is designed to be clean and intuitive: upload your file, click a button, and your Base64 data URI is immediately ready to copy. This level of convenience is essential in agile development environments where speed and efficiency are paramount.
Enhances Compatibility and Code Performance
This is where the tool truly shines. By converting a WebP image to Base64, you can embed it directly into your code. This eliminates an HTTP request, which is a fundamental web performance optimization. When applied to the already-small WebP format, the performance gains can be significant. It also enhances compatibility by allowing you to include image data in text-only systems, such as in a JSON response from an API.
Boosts Productivity for Developers and Designers
For developers focused on performance, this tool is a must-have. It simplifies a key optimization technique and makes it accessible to everyone. For designers, it provides a straightforward way to provide developers with ready-to-embed, highly optimized assets. By bridging the gap between design and high-performance implementation, this free online WebP encoding utility boosts the productivity of the entire team.
How to Use the WebP to Base64 Converter Tool
Our tool is designed with a focus on simplicity, enabling you to get your Base64-encoded WebP image in three quick and easy steps.
Step 1 – Upload Your Input
To start, you need to provide the WebP image you want to encode. Click the “Upload” button and select the .webp
file from your computer. The tool will load your image and prepare it for conversion.
Step 2 – Click the Convert/Generate Button
Once your WebP file is loaded, simply click the “Convert” button. The tool’s client-side engine will read the image’s binary data and instantly perform the Base64 encoding. This entire process happens securely within your browser, with no data being sent to any servers.
Step 3 – Copy or Download the Output
The tool will generate the complete Base64 data URI, which includes the necessary prefix (data:image/webp;base64,
) followed by the encoded string. You can click the “Copy” button to copy the entire string to your clipboard. This string is now ready to be pasted directly into your CSS or HTML.
Features of Our WebP to Base64 Converter Tool
Our converter is built with a feature set that prioritizes a secure, efficient, and user-friendly experience for all.
- 100% Free and Web-Based: This utility is available completely free of charge, with no restrictions. As a browser-based application, it’s accessible from anywhere with an internet connection.
- No Registration or Login Needed: We value your time and privacy. You can start converting your WebP files immediately without the need for any registration or login.
- Instant and Accurate Results: The converter uses standardized encoding algorithms to ensure the Base64 output is both generated instantly and is a perfectly accurate representation of the input image.
- Works on Desktop, Tablet, and Mobile: With a fully responsive design, the tool works flawlessly across all devices, allowing you to convert images whether you’re on a desktop computer or a mobile device.
- Privacy-Focused – Input/Output Not Stored: Your data’s security is our highest priority. All encoding is performed locally in your browser. Your image files and the resulting Base64 strings are never uploaded or stored on our servers.
Who Can Benefit from a WebP to Base64 Converter?
The utility of a WebP to Base64 Converter extends to any professional involved in creating modern, high-performance web experiences.
- Front-End Developers: They are the primary audience, using the tool to inline critical images like logos, icons, and above-the-fold graphics to maximize page load speed.
- UI/UX Designers: Designers can use this tool to package their optimized WebP assets into a simple text string, ensuring an easy and accurate handoff to developers.
- SEO Experts: Technical SEOs use this technique to improve Core Web Vitals, such as Largest Contentful Paint (LCP) and First Contentful Paint (FCP), which are crucial ranking factors.
- Mobile App Developers: When building hybrid apps using web technologies, embedding assets as data URIs can simplify package management and improve rendering performance.
- Students & Educators: The tool is an excellent practical resource for teaching advanced web performance optimization and the benefits of modern image formats.
Linked WebP vs. Base64 WebP – Comparison Table
Deciding whether to embed your WebP images or link to them involves a trade-off between reducing server requests and increasing initial document size. This table breaks down the key considerations.
Feature | Linked WebP (<img src="image.webp"> ) | Base64 Embedded WebP (url('data:image/webp;base64,...') ) |
Format Type | External Binary File Request | Inline Text Data URI |
Usability | Easy to manage and update as a separate file. Leverages browser caching. | Becomes part of the HTML/CSS document. Harder to update but portable with the code. |
Performance | Requires a separate HTTP request, which can delay rendering. Caching improves performance on subsequent visits. | Eliminates an HTTP request, speeding up initial rendering. Cannot be cached separately from the parent document. |
File Size | The original, highly compressed size of the .webp file. | Increases the already small file size by an additional ~33%. |
Best For | Larger images, images that appear on multiple pages, and content below the fold where caching is beneficial. | Small, critical images like logos and icons that are needed for the initial page view to appear complete. |
Tools You May Find Useful
Optimizing your images with a WebP to Base64 Converter is a fantastic step, but it’s often part of a much larger workflow. If you’re starting with older image formats, you’ll first want to convert them to WebP to take advantage of its superior compression. Our platform offers a complete suite of Image Converter Tools, including a JPG to WebP Converter and a PNG to WebP Converter.
Once your images are in the right format, you might need to encode other assets. For vector graphics, our SVG to Base64 Converter is the perfect tool. If you need to handle legacy formats, we also offer a GIF to Base64 Converter.
Sometimes you’ll need to work in reverse. Our Base64 to Image Converter can decode a data URI back into an image file, which is useful for debugging. You may also need to handle other data types, such as with our Text to Base64 Converter or JSON to Base64 Converter.
To ensure the integrity of your data and assets, generating a cryptographic hash with our SHA256 Generator is a standard security practice. And for designers, creating the perfect color scheme is simplified with tools like our Color Palette Generator and HEX to RGB Converter. By leveraging this full suite of utilities, you can build a highly efficient and optimized development process.
Frequently Asked Questions (FAQs)
What does a WebP to Base64 Converter do?
This tool takes a modern WebP image file and encodes its binary data into a Base64 text string. This string, known as a data URI, allows you to embed the highly compressed WebP image directly into an HTML or CSS file, which can improve website performance.
Is this WebP to Base64 Converter safe to use?
Yes, it is completely secure. Our tool operates entirely on the client-side, meaning the conversion process happens in your browser. Your WebP files are never uploaded to our servers, ensuring your data remains 100% private.
Why is WebP better than JPEG or PNG for the web?
WebP offers significantly better compression than older formats. A WebP image can be 25-35% smaller than a JPEG of comparable quality, and a lossless WebP can be up to 26% smaller than a PNG. Smaller file sizes mean faster website load times.
When should I embed WebP images using Base64?
Embedding is best for small, critical images like icons, logos, or hero images that appear “above the fold.” This technique eliminates a server request and can make the page feel faster. For larger images, it’s better to link to them as separate files to take advantage of browser caching.
How do I use the generated Base64 code?
In CSS, you would use the data URI inside a url()
function, like this: background-image: url('data:image/webp;base64,PASTE_YOUR_CODE_HERE');
. In HTML, you would use it as the src
for an <img>
tag: <img src="data:image/webp;base64,PASTE_YOUR_CODE_HERE" alt="My WebP Image">
.
Does converting to Base64 affect the quality of my WebP image?
No, not at all. Base64 is a lossless encoding method. It simply represents the binary data of the image as text. The decoded image will be a pixel-perfect reconstruction of the original WebP file.
Will the animation in an animated WebP file be preserved?
Yes. The converter encodes the entire file, including all animation frames and timing data. When you use the Base64 data URI in a browser, the animated WebP will play just like the original file.